def run(self): """ Run # Setup config: retunrs the config dictionary and true/false on custom # Parse commandline # i686 check - change branch to x32-$branch # sanitize config # Check network # Update mirror pool # Check if mirrorlist is not to be touched - normal exit # Handle missing network # Load default mirror pool # Build mirror list """ (self.config, self.custom) = config_setup.setup_config() fileFn.create_dir(self.config["work_dir"]) cliFn.parse_command_line(self, gtk_available=GTK_AVAILABLE) util.i686_check(self, write=True) util.aarch64_check(self, write=True) if not config_setup.sanitize_config(config=self.config): sys.exit(2) self.network = httpFn.check_internet_connection(tty=self.tty) if self.network: httpFn.download_mirror_pool(config=self.config, tty=self.tty, quiet=self.quiet) if self.no_mirrorlist: sys.exit(0) if not self.network: if not self.quiet: pacman_mirrors.functions.util.internet_message(tty=self.tty) self.config["method"] = "random" self.fasttrack = False """ # Load configured mirror pool """ defaultFn.load_config_mirror_pool(self) """ # Decide which type of mirrorlist to create * Fasttrack * Interactive * Default """ if self.use_async: util.async_disclaimer() resp = input() if resp.lower() == "n": exit(0) if self.fasttrack: fasttrack.build_mirror_list(self, limit=self.fasttrack) elif self.interactive: interactive.build_mirror_list(self) else: common.build_mirror_list(self)
